Powered by the replacement Halford H1 taken from the prototype de Havilland Vampire … In late July 1909, Orville Wright and another first lieutenant from the Aeronautical Division, Benjamin Foulois, took the plane for a speed test on its final qualifying flight. It successfully flew south about 5 miles before turning back. The craft reached an altitude of 400 feet and averaged 42.5 miles per hour. Though it's a military aircraft, … can maple cabinets be paintedWebThe Military Flyer banking left over the crowds at Fort Myer. The Military Flyer was moved to Fort Sam Houston near San Antonio, Texas on February 15, 1910. In August, Oliver G. Simmons – the first U.S. military flight mechanic – installed wheels on the aircraft so the crew could launch it without using the catapult. fixed bridge teeth
